Bienvenidos a PintxoPote! (pronounced 'pincho potay') a pintxos (tapas) bar offering a dining experience showcasing the range of traditional flavors typical of the Basque country in Northern Spain. Here, you will be transported to the world's most acclaimed culinary region: the seaside resort of San Sebastián, a region whose cuisine is distinguished by the excellence of the ingredients and the simplicity in cooking techniques.

Pintxo Pote is the only place in the SF Bay area that offers a current expression of authentic pintxos.

Brought to you by Award Winning Chef Michael Chiarello and located at Pier 5 on the bustling San Francisco Waterfront, Coqueta is inspired by the cuisines of Spain. Chef Chiarello feels that Spain’s signature ‘small plates’ coupled with the social vibrancy of their dining scene is the perfect combination for San Francisco, which has its own deep-rooted history with the country. Focusing on regional dishes from Madrid, Catalonia, the Basque Country and beyond, the menu will feature Chiarello's interpretation of traditional Spanish cuisine and, as has always been his tradition, will highlight the bounty of fresh, local ingredients from land and sea.

Coqueta means “flirt” or “infatuation” in Spanish, and represents Michael Chiarello and his team’s exploration and interpretation of Spanish Cuisine, wine and inspired cocktails, while highlighting the bounty of Northern California.
